Glover Garden

Glover Garden opened in 1974 on the Minamiyamate hill as an outdoor museum. Named after the Scottish trader Thomas Blake Glover, it relocates and displays Meiji-era Western buildings from around Nagasaki, including the Former Glover House. In 2015 it was registered as a component of the Sites of Japan's Meiji Industrial Revolution.
